Sažetak
The potency assay for the freeze-dried live attenuated rubella vaccine is a cell culture based biological assay. To revise the standard operating conditions and enhance the flexibility of the assay performance, the robustness testing of the rubella vaccine potency assay was performed. Seven intra- assay operating conditions that could have an effect on the assay performance were identified and their influence on the overall assay variability investigated by fractional factorial design of experiments (DoE) with resolution IV (2IV(7-3)). The robustness testing through DoE showed that the rubella vaccine potency assay is a robust assay. Critical operating conditions can be identified by using DoE, which indicates that it is a suitable approach in bioassay robustness studies.
